MSSU volleyball falls to Central Missouri

(From MSSU Lions Athletic News)

The Missouri Southern volleyball team fell three sets to none tonight at 19th ranked Central Missouri. Individual set scores were 17-25, 14-25 and 22-25.

The Lions (6-21, 3-16 MIAA) were led offensively by Katie Politte (pictured) as she collected eight kills and 14 digs, to go along with three blocks. Abby Finder dished out 21 assists and added 14 digs, while Callie Whetstone had seven blocks and five kills.

Central (19-8, 16-3 MIAA) had two in double-figures for kills, led by 14 from Carly Sojka.

The Jennies took sets one and two easily, with only one tied score and no lead changes.

Southern, wouldn't go away easily as the Lions took a 9-8 lead ona kill from Whetstone and led 11-8 after a kill from Krishna Merriman. The Lions led 20-17, but Central tied the match at 20 and led 22-21, before a kill from Wetstone tied the set at 22. Three-straight poitns from the Jennies gave the match to UCM.

The Lions will be back in action tomorrow as Southern travels to Lindenwood for a 7 pm match.
